Author: J. Shirley Anderson

Anderson, John Shirley (Melbourne, Australia, May 9, 1895-August 31, 1970, Rosebud, Victoria, Australia) Studied at the University of Melbourne, B.A., and was ordained to the Presbyterian ministry in 1931. He received his B.D. degree from the same university in 1935. A quiet, devoted pastor, he served Presbyterian congregations in Clunes, 1931-1936; Malvern East, 1936-1940; Yallourn, 1940-1945; Stratford, 1945-1951; Wonthaggi, 1951-1957; and Coleraine, 1957-1960, all within his native state of Victoria. After retirement in 1960, he lived in Rosebud. --Wesley Milgate, DNAH Archives Go to person page >
